The Enterprise team are responsible for a variety of services offered to our customers. These include:

  • Bespoke hardware/software developments to provide customers with the ability to better manage their remote site traffic and user experience, as part of an NSSLGlobal solution.
  • The design and management of the NSSLGlobal VSAT infrastructure, including requirements capture, capacity planning, link budget design, hub IP network design, traffic shaping, traffic acceleration, VoIP and systems management.
  • The design and management of our Global PoP infrastructure, including Mobile Satellite, LTE, and terrestrial interconnect incorporating tasks including capacity planning, hub IP network design, VoIP, traffic monitoring/detection and systems management.

This role is to lead and work as part of a team in the system design/development processes, using bespoke and open-source software, primarily Linux based, to bring additional value to our in-house and customer solutions. In co-ordination with the Head of Technology, they will also lead and mentor the Developer and Graduate Developer.

Existing solutions you will be involved in developing/maintaining include our in-house product ranges incorporating VoIP platforms, email services, file replication, hotspot solutions, software distribution, web filtering, firewalling, Hypervisors, High-Availability and Entertainment services. The main development software technologies include Debian, Apache, MySQL, Python, PHP, ReactJS and NodeJS.

As part of this role, we expect the employee to continuously improve their skillset in software versioning and task management. The main hardware technologies are digital satellite communications, IP networking, and VoIP. We would expect the candidate to have working knowledge of some or all of these technologies.
